Abstract

The article examines media law, specifically the creation of the Journalist's Conscience Clause Act. First published by the Spanish Constitutional Court in December 2002, the Clause serves several purposes which include upholding a journalist's moral and ethical integrity as well as procedural processes to be incorporated when a journalist feels the need to leave due to moral violations. One of the most debated aspects of the conscience clause is whether fiscal compensation should be awarded if a journalist were to leave his employer.
